How does being health-literate help you avoid health fraud?

Health
1 answer:
Jobisdone [24]2 years ago
3 0

The correct answer is; helping to make an informed and understanding options in your own health care.

Further Explanation:

Health fraud is a growing concern all over the world. There are scrupulous people and businesses who market their items as cures when they are nothing more than placebo pills and creams. There is no magic pills or creams that can cure cancer or make you appear younger.

Being informed and educated about health care and products will save money and time. Always see a licensed health care provider for any issues that you may have.

List the three different kinds of<br> multiple pregnancies
masya89 [10]

Answer:

  1. Fraternal twins. Two separate eggs are fertilised and implant in the uterus
  2. Identical twins. Identical twins are formed when a single fertilised egg is split in half
  3. Triplets and 'higher order multiples' (HOMs)

When is the BEST time to be tested for HIV? A. immediately after possible exposure B. two to three weeks after possible exposure
olya-2409 [2.1K]
Hey there!

There is a window period between being exposed to HIV and getting accurate results as to whether or not you have actually been infected. Many HIV tests can detect an infection two to three weeks after initial exposure. If someone tests negative on many HIV tests after two weeks since the possible exposure, they're likely HIV-negative, but should still get tested after a certain amount of additional time since everyone can react to the infection differently. 

Your answer will be your second option.
